Hi Julien, I have a local archive of DRAC 5 firmware files that I used years ago.
In it I have a Firmware 1.65 folder that contains: 23387512 Aug 16 2012 firmimg.d5 I am sure I used it many times with success via the web gui upload method. If you are trying to upload exe files instead of d5 files, that may be the problem. Unzip the exe file to get the d5 file. Best I can tell, we did not have iDrac 5 releases that correspond to the versions and dates you have noted. Please ensure that you are not attempting to use an iDrac6 image. What version of FW are you currently running? You might try upgrading to the version immediately following the version you are currently running. You may have to slowly work your way up to the latest by upgrading to each version sequentially.
